Makeover for Christmas Decorations
There are a few things that you can do before you finally set up the home for the decorations. The points mentioned below are the preliminary Christmas home décor preparations to undertake. Let us see what these include.
1. Aromatic Candles- If you want extra lighting for Christmas, you can use pillar candles, tall tapering candles, and floating ones. For added aroma, cinnamon and vanilla candles are helpful.
2. Uniformity in Christmas Décor- To maintain uniformity, you can use ribbons, candles, and cushions of the same color all over the house for the Christmas home décor.
3. Avoid Cluttered Tables – Try not to use a tablecloth that has prints or patterns that will make the table look cluttered. The tone must be that of a festivity. If possible, complement the crockery and cloth along with fresh flowers.
4. Serving Tray/Trolley- For serving, if you are using a trolley or a tray, ensure to decorate both with the same color cloth on the tray.
5. Main Door – As far as Christmas decorations for the main door is concerned, you can hang a huge star-shaped lantern. A fresh green wreath will add elegance to the star if you hang the latter, too. Alternatively, you can keep a red poinsettia plant close to the door in your bedroom and use the same color for pillows and bed covers. Also, you can place matching rugs and doormats.

Red, gold, and white will add to the festive mood. You can select this color scheme for all the decorations you carry out for your home.
If you put a Christmas tree at home, avoid using huge trees. Add as many accessories as will look good on the tree. Refrain from clutter unnecessarily. You might be tempted to add more Christmas home decorations or stuff for your Christmas décor, but refrain from making it clumsy and chaotic.
